Wall Surface Maintenance



Evaluating walls for any kind of imperfections and promptly addressing them via required repair work is crucial for attaining a smooth and remarkable paint task. Prior to starting the painting process, thoroughly analyze the wall surfaces for cracks, openings, damages, or any other damages that could impact the final result.

Beginning by completing any kind of splits or openings with spackling substance, enabling it to completely dry entirely prior to sanding it down to produce a smooth surface area. For larger damages or damaged locations, take into consideration using joint compound to ensure a smooth repair.

In addition, look for any loose paint or wallpaper that might require to be gotten rid of. Scrape off any pe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face area to produce an uniform appearance.

Cleaning and Surface Area Preparation



To ensure a pristine and well-prepared surface area for painting, the following step involves thoroughly cleaning and prepping the walls. Begin by dusting the walls with a microfiber cloth or a duster to remove any loosened dust, cobwebs, or debris.

For even more stubborn dust or grime, a solution of moderate detergent and water can be made use of to gently scrub the wall surfaces, adhered to by a detailed rinse with clean water. Pay special focus to locations near light buttons, door takes care of, and walls, as these tend to gather even more dirt.

After cleansing, it is important to check the wall surfaces for any kind of cracks, holes, or blemishes. These should be filled with spackling substance and sanded smooth as soon as completely dry. Sanding the wall surfaces lightly with fine-grit sandpaper will certainly also assist produce an uniform surface area for painting.

Priming and Taping



Before paint, the wall surfaces should be topped to ensure correct attachment of the paint and taped to protect surrounding surfaces from roaming brushstrokes. Priming acts as a crucial step in the painting procedure, especially for brand-new drywall or surfaces that have been patched or fixed. Additionally, primer can boost the longevity and coverage of the paint, eventually bring about a more specialist and long-lasting finish.

When it concerns taping, utilizing pain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and various other surfaces you want to shield is vital to accomplish tidy and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is created to be easily used and gotten rid of without damaging the underlying surface or leaving any type of residue. Make the effort to appropriately tape off areas before repainting to conserve yourself the problem of touch-ups in the future.
